WSE Settings 3.0 problems (Soap protocol factory)

I'm very new to the WSE subject, but I seem to be having an issue which so
far as I can tell shouldn't be happening.
Dev PC and Visual Studio config:
- XP Pro on an AD network
- Office 2003 Pro
- VS 2005, with SP1
- WSE 3.0
- VSTO 2005, with SP1
- VSTO 2005 SE
- Dundas Charting (ASP.NET Pro)
(This is a recently re-built PC, so registry should be pretty clean.)
I'm following the steps outlined in the WSE Documentation for configuring a
web service.
I created a new project of type "ASP.NET Web Service Application".
For this project, I right-clicked it in Solution Explorer and selected "WSE
Settings 3.0..."
In the WSE dialogue, I checked the box to enable WSE on the project.
At this point, the checkbox for "Enable Microsoft Web Services Enhancements
Soap Protocol Factory" is greyed out.
Have I missed something? Is there some sort of configuration conflict in
the add-ons for VS? Or is the WSE settings just flaky?
I'm using VB.NET as the preferred language, but I have tried using the C#
version of a web service, with the same problem.
I have read the posting in this group by Tony Girgenti ("RE: Need help with
.... SoapContext error" 15/02/2007 21:52), which seems to cover a similar
issue, except he seems to have successfuly been able to check the soap
protocol box when he created a new blank web service project. I can't seem
to even get this.
Any pointers would be greatly appreciated.
